Project Needs and Beneficiaries

The Rehabilitation Treatment Centre in Laos provides free health checks to patients, and provides low cost alternative treatments to in-patients and out-patients suffering with disease and sickness. The clinic is based in a beautiful remote part of Laos, and only uses electricity generated through bio-gas. There is no running water at the centre and they desperately need a filtration system for clean drinking water. The clinic also needs medical equipment.

Activities

We will install a water filtration system to provide clean drinking water to patients suffering with serious sickness and disease. We will fund medical equipment and medicines to treat patients We will fund research into traditional medicines

SEDA has raised approximately 10% of the project fundraising. We are still urgent more donors to supports the RTC. While RTC is trying to match with GlobalGiving fund to help complete this project within next six months.

RTC is trying to solve the electricity problem how to get the pump work and while bring in the electricity to area.

At this same, the RTC is critically important in Laos because it provides free health checks to patients, as well as low cost alternative treatments to both in-patients and out-patients suffering from disease and sickness.

The RTC is now seeking funding to help reconstruct their current building which has been severely damaged by termites. At this same time we are hoping to have new water treatment equipment set up to RTC within six months.
